We have now agreed upon a slogan for next year's 23rd event 'Le Tour de Tours'. This is to echo the name of 'Le Tour de France', the cycling world's premier event and to reflect the fact that we shall be visiting Tours, the beautiful main city of the Loire region, but not Paris or Versailles, for the first time in the ride's history. We have also decided upon entry fees, after much debate, having reserved rooms in hotels at all destinations, even Alencon (!) and so able to have a pretty good idea of costs. The results of the post-ride questionnaire were most encouraging, with 100% of riders saying that the Ride was good value for money and giving us the mandate to raise the entry fee, by up to 14.3% on average, although we won't be taking this up, at least for now! Entry fees for the 375-mile longer ride are £395 and for 250-mile shorter ride, £295.
Plans For 2008
As mentioned last month, the route is: St Malo - Rennes - Laval - Angers - Tours - Alencon - Caen, with the shorter ride joining the 6-Dayers en route to Angers. We are going out on Sunday 13th July, Tuesday 15th for the shorter ride and returning on Sunday 20th July 2008. Reservation forms will be available from the beginning of November and the full entry form in January.
